ERIK HAYDENStaff Writer The Pepperdine women’s lacrosse team completed a successful season that saw the Waves ranked in the top 20th nationally and included some memorable victories. The team finished with a 9-7 record and barely missed the WWLL Division II championship when it lost the title game April 22 to Cal Poly San Luis Obispo, 10-9.
